When I make accidentally a let serve touching the net, should I make the same serve again or make another serve?

Hi Kaustubh,

If you think the serve is going to be effective, then try it again.  I often see players trying a serve that is going to be really effective and serving a let.  They then change serves and often forget about the serve for the rest of the match.

When you serve the let, see if the player looks like they are comfortable with it or not.
